The Core Mechanics and Rising Tension

At its heart, the gameplay of most chicken road-style games revolves around incredibly simple controls. Typically, a single tap or click is used to make the chicken move forward, advancing it across the lanes of traffic. The core challenge lies in timing these movements to coincide with gaps in the flow of vehicles. Initial levels often present a relatively slow and predictable traffic pattern, allowing players to learn the basic rhythm and develop their timing. However, as progress is made, the difficulty curve steepens dramatically. Vehicles begin to accelerate, appear more frequently, and sometimes exhibit unpredictable behavior, demanding lightning-fast reflexes and precise judgment.

The inherent tension in the game stems from the immediate consequences of failure. A single collision with a vehicle results in instant game over, forcing the player to start over from the beginning. This high-stakes environment creates a sense of urgency and encourages careful planning and execution. Players are constantly weighing the risks and rewards of each movement, calculating the distance and speed of oncoming traffic, and anticipating potential hazards. The adrenaline rush of narrowly avoiding a collision becomes a significant part of the overall experience.

Mastering the Timing and Anticipating Patterns

While luck plays a small role, success in the chicken road game is primarily dependent on honing the player’s ability to anticipate traffic patterns. Paying close attention to the speed and spacing of the vehicles is crucial. Over time, players learn to recognize subtle cues that indicate safe opportunities to cross. Experienced players don’t simply react to the immediate situation; they predict where gaps will appear and position the chicken accordingly. This predictive element transforms the game from a purely reflexive challenge into a more strategic one.

Furthermore, many variations of the game introduce different types of vehicles with varying speeds and sizes. Learning to differentiate between these vehicles and adjust the timing accordingly is essential for progression. Some games also incorporate power-ups or special abilities that can temporarily slow down traffic, grant invincibility, or provide other advantages, adding another layer of complexity to the gameplay. Mastering these nuances can significantly improve a player’s chances of success and unlock higher scores.

The Psychology of Addictive Gameplay

The enduring popularity of the chicken road game isn’t simply down to its simple mechanics; it’s rooted in psychological principles that make it highly addictive. The core loop of risk, reward, and immediate feedback is particularly effective. Each successful crossing provides a small dopamine hit, reinforcing the behavior and motivating the player to continue. The quick restarts after a failed attempt minimize frustration and keep the player engaged. The game's inherent challenge promotes a “just one more try” mentality, compelling players to refine their skills and push their limits.

The escalating difficulty also plays a role in maintaining engagement. As the game becomes more challenging, players feel a sense of accomplishment when they overcome obstacles and achieve new milestones. This constant sense of progress, however small, keeps them invested in the experience. The game taps into a primal need for mastery and provides a tangible way to measure improvement. This sense of self-efficacy is incredibly rewarding and contributes to the game’s overall appeal. The seemingly endless nature of the game, with no inherent ending, encourages persistent play and a desire to reach higher scores.

Variations and Evolution of the Formular

While the core concept of guiding a chicken across a road remains consistent, the chicken road game has undergone numerous variations and evolutions over the years. Developers have introduced new environments, characters, obstacles, and power-ups to keep the gameplay fresh and engaging. Some games feature different types of roads – highways, railroad tracks, even rivers – each presenting unique challenges. Others introduce different animals, such as ducks, frogs, or even dinosaurs, each with its own characteristics and abilities.

These variations often extend beyond just visual changes. Some games incorporate new mechanics, such as the ability to jump over obstacles, collect items, or earn rewards for completing challenges. Others introduce more complex traffic patterns or dynamic weather conditions that affect gameplay. The creativity of developers has resulted in a diverse range of chicken road-style games, each offering a unique twist on the original formula. This constant innovation ensures that the genre remains appealing to both veteran players and newcomers alike.
